Recipe tips for Easy Apple Pie Bites:

  • You can use either homemade or store-bought pie crust for these.  If making vegan just make sure to use a vegan pie crust.
  • I enjoyed dipping mine into a homemade caramel sauce but you could also serve with ice cream or whipped cream.
  • I’ve been loving using my non-stick baking mat this season, but you could also use parchment paper if you like.
  • I also like using a fairly large baking sheet so you can bake them all at the same time instead of in batches.

Easy Apple Pie Bites


  • Author: She Likes Food
  • Prep Time: 25 mins
  • Cook Time: 25 mins
  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: 16 1x
  • Category: Dessert, Vegan
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American
Print Recipe
Pin Recipe

Description

These Easy Apple Pie Bites are perfect for when you’re craving apple pie but don’t want to make one!


Ingredients

  • 2–3 large apples, peeled cored and sliced into about 8 slices each
  • 1/3 cup melted coconut oil
  • 1 tablespoon coconut sugar
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on corn starch or arrowroot
  • 1 pinch salt
  • 1/2 cup almond milk, or egg wash if not making vegan
  • 2 tablespoons raw sugar, for topping if desired
  • 1 double pie crust, store-bought or homemade (I used my Perfect Coconut Oil Pie Crust Recipe)
  • Your favorite dip, ice cream or whipped cream (I used my Easy Vegan Caramel Sauce)

Instructions

  1. Pre-heat oven to 375 degrees F.   Add the coconut oil, sugar, cinnamon and salt to a large bowl and mix until combined.  Next, add the apple slices and stir until all apple slices are equally coated.
  2. Roll out pie crust to about 1/8 inch thick.  Use a 2 inch round cookie cutter to cut out pie crust.  Place one slice of apple in the middle of the pie crust and then carefully fold around the apple until the dough in the middle of the apple is touching and press together.
  3. Place apple pie bites on a large baking sheet topped with a non-stick mat or parchment paper.  Brush the top of each with almond milk and sprinkle with raw sugar.
  4. Bake apple pie bites until pie crust is baked through and apples are fork tender, 20-25 minutes.
  5. Best when served warm with your favorite topping.
